Description:
In the last year crypto-currencies such as
Bitcon have become popular.
This project proposes a new crypto-currency system which
allows music artists to upload their music in MP3 format to the
website that I implement and earn the currency I have create. The currency amount
depends on how long the website users listening to the music.
The technology which I am going to use are JavaScript for the front end of website,
Php for the back end of website,
One way function to do the hash encryption for currency coin.
